1.1 This test method addresses resistance to ballistic penetration and to backface deformation (BFD) for ballisticresistant torso body armor and shoot packs. 1.2 This test method is intended for testing of soft body armor, hard armor plates, in conjunction with armor, and shoot packs mounted on a clay block as the backing assembly. NOTE 1—This test method does not apply to ballistic helmets, inserts, trauma packs, trauma plates, or accessories. 1.3 The test method does not specify performance criteria or usage of the test results. 1.4 This test method does not address conditioning of test items. 1.5 It is anticipated that this test method will be referenced by certifiers, purchasers, or other users in order to meet their specific needs. 1.5.1 Purchasers and other users will specify the ballistic test threats to be used. Within this test method, the reference defining the ballistic test threats is called the “test threats document.” 1.5.2 In this test method, “other standards and specifications” and “unless specified elsewhere” refer to documents (for example, military standards, purchase specifications) that require the use of this test method. Purchasers and other users are responsible for the “other standards and specifications” and for specifying any requirements that supersede those of this test method. 1.6 Units—The values stated in either SI units or inchpound units are to be regarded separately as standard. The values stated in each system are not necessarily exact equivalents; therefore, to ensure conformance with the standard, each system shall be used independently of the other, and values from the two systems shall not be combined. 1.6.1 The user of this standard will identify the system of units to be used, and it is critical to ensure that any crossreferenced standards maintain consistency of units between standards. 1.7 This standard does not purport to address all of the safety concerns, if any, associated with its use.
